The two were identified thanks to the cameras of the public transport
CAGLIARI. The state police denounced a 56-year-old offender from Selargius and his minor son, who attacked the driver of a city bus on the evening of 29 April last year. The man and his son are charged with aggravated injuries in competition.
The offender, aboard his car in the company of his son, had chased the public transport which, according to him, had not given him priority shortly before. As soon as the bus stopped, he got on board and hit the driver in the face with a stone. His son had also supported his father, kicking the driver.
The bus driver, bruised and wounded in the left eye, was transported from 118 to the emergency room, in yellow code, and was discharged with a prognosis of 7 days.
The investigators of the “Crimes against the person” section of the mobile squad identified the attacker thanks to the images of the public transport cameras and the testimonies of the passengers present who, with their cell phones, had also filmed the scene.
